dc.description.abstractThis study was carried out to determine the cutting properties of different wine grape canes as a function of moisture content, canes' diameter and variety. Cutting properties of cutting force, cutting strength, cutting energy and specific cutting energy were measured in eight different wine grape varieties. Canes of 'Tannat', 'Merlot', 'Cot', 'Chardonnay', 'Viograier', 'Cabernet Sauvignon', 'Shiraz' and 'Cabernet Franc' were profiled for their cutting properties during the dormant season. The results of data analysis showed that there was a significant difference between mean values of cutting properties varying based on variety. The results demonstrated that the maximum cutting force, cutting strength and cutting energy for 'Cabernet Franc' grape variety were 1397.60 N, 21.68 MPa and 3.68 J, respectively. The minimum cutting force, cutting strength and cutting energy were obtained at 'Tannest' grape variety and it was 981.65 N, 13.94 MPa, and 2.39 J, respectively. Whereas, the maximum specific cutting energy obtained at 'Chardonnay' was 0.256 Jmm-2, while the minimum specific cutting energy obtained at 'Tannat' grape variety was 0.219 Jmm(-2). In conclusion, findings demonstrated that the cutting properties were related to the physiological, physical and mechanical properties of the grew. branches. Therefore, the grape variety should be taken into account for the design of a suitable pruner machine.en_US
